About this chess game
This chess game between Alex Barclay (2422) and Pedro Vertíz Gutiérrez (1981) was played at Interzonal TT11 in 2021 and finished ½–½. The opening was the Sicilian Defense: Nyezhmetdinov-Rossolimo Attack, Fianchetto Variation (B31).
